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 3 Dormitorios en Knightdale

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en Knightdale?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en Knightdale es $2,066.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Knightdale ?

A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Knightdale es una unidad de 1,779 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,380 en Elevate Riverview.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en Knightdale?

El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en Knightdale es actualmente de 2,382 pies cuadrados.
